The Cotswolds is well known for gentle hillsides, outstanding countryside with river valleys, water meadows and beech woods, sleepy ancient limestone villages and historic market towns, where time has stood still for over 300 years. Our base for this tour, Banbury is a historic market town famous for its’ Cross, cakes and ‘Ride a cock horse to Banbury Cross’ nursery rhyme. Banbury is a vibrant mix of traditional and historic town against a backdrop of modern living. The narrow streets and hidden lanes of historic Banbury form part of a historic town trail.
